Q: Is 414,814 a Prime Number?
A: No, 414,814 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 414814 can be evenly divided by 1 2 433 479 866 958 207,407 and 414,814, with no remainder.
Since 414,814 cannot be divided by just 1 and 414,814, it is not a prime number.
